Prep Golf: Bulldog boys get dual win over CWC

The Harrisburg boys' golf team picked up a 10-stroke win over visiting Carmi-white County Monday at Shawnee Hills Country Club, winning 160-170.

Harrisburg's Grant Wilson took medalist honors with a 34, while the Bulldogs got a 38 from Ashton Hall, a 41 from Brent Lawrence and a 47 from Hayden Emery.

Also contributing for Harrisburg was Evan McDermott (50) and Ethan Golish (55).

<b>McClusky leads Harrisburg girls to triangular win</b>

Madison McClusky took medalist honors for Harrisburg, shooting a 39 and helping the Bulldogs to a triangular win over Carmi-White County and Hamilton County Monday afternoon.

Harrisburg shot a 180, while both Hamilton County and CWC each shot a 203.

The Bulldogs got a 40 from Frankie Leigh Nicholes and a 45 from Gracie Behnke, while Hannah Jones rounded out the team scoring with a 56.

Laura Behnke (60) and Kailyn Harrison (71) also contributed for Harrisburg.

The Southern Illinois River-To-River Conference girls' golf tournament was scheduled for Tuesday, but rain pushed the event to today (Wednesday) and will be played at Pine Lakes Golf Course in Herrin.

On Thursday, the SIRR Conference boys' golf tournament is expected to be played at Hickory Ridge.
